About making this video:
Basically, I did three videos & combined them into one. The first, is the background, which changes colours and pulses to the song (eg, guitar riff I went from blue to purple, & bright white for percussion highlights). The patterns came from The Reflex and Skin Trade videos. The 2nd video is the popular footage of the band playing live in Japan, back in 2003. The 3rd is an "artsy-fartsy" statement, comparing "viral organisms" to "computer viruses" to mankind being a "viral" type threat to the Earth (no, I'm not a tree hugger). I used footage from the film "KOYAANISQATSI" for a lot of the "stock film footage". If you haven't seen it, rent it, buy it, or watch it here on YouTube. It's very cool. It's about an hour and a half of amazing camerawork & time lapse photography set to strange music (Philip Glass) which suits the images perfectly. It's basically what you saw in my video. Thanks for various footage from around the YouTube world (see credits)....OK, the white dot at the end (for those who asked), when you turned an old TV off (70's & earlier) a white dot would stay in the middle of the screen for about 5 min.
All done on iMovie on my iMac.
